Dr. Sun Yat-sen and the Turmoil of Early 20th Century China

This chapter examines Dr. Sun Yat-sen's challenges in founding a republic during the decline of the Qing Dynasty, amidst foreign intervention and internal chaos. It highlights the stark contrasts between the lives of foreign traders in treaty ports and the dire realities faced by ordinary Chinese citizens. Additionally, it reflects on the historical context of foreign control, including the lasting impacts of unequal treaties on Chinese society.
